This work was created in response to those who have given everything—home, safety, and ultimately their lives—in pursuit of freedom, and those who remain behind, suspended in waiting. It does not attempt to argue what is right or wrong, nor to propose solutions. Instead, it sits inside the emotional aftermath: hopelessness, anger, grief, exposure, and the exhausting act of watching. The multiplied eyes reference both collective witnessing and enforced vigilance—looking outward for intervention, and inward for meaning, while receiving neither. The face becomes a site of accumulation rather than identity, carrying too many gazes, too many expectations, and no place to rest them. This work reflects the experience of being abandoned by time and power, where hope persists not as optimism but as a reflex—an involuntary act of survival. The painting is not about heroism; it is about what remains after sacrifice, when the world continues to look back in silence.
